It is called asexual reproduction. Asexual reproduction is common with certain plants, like strawberries. Cloning also involves one parent. What happens is they find a female animal that is the same breed as the animal. Then they remove the egg, take out its nucleus replcing it with th nuclus of the cell of the animal they are cloning, and replant the egg back into its animal the egg came from. Then when the animal is born, it has no resemblance to its mother, but looks similar to the animal cloned. I hoped i helped.

Prosperty seems to be the one factor that slows a population's growth. It is a natural paradox. Every other species on earth grows it population when there is plenty of food, but humans populations grow fastest in poverty stricken agricultural societies and slowest in wealthy industrial societies. France has the lowest birth rate in the world, and even the United States has had a negative growth rate for many years. Both countries rely on immigration to swell the ranks for their work force.
